Output 05abe8c26cf172dd1abcdeb1fe23e829e9e54f11900f372670c4b22f8a997983:0

value
79296578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15ab8f3c3c45bc95978911cd194777dcafc691cc OP_EQUAL
address
33fbdjeZmBySVfYAAmRViNtaT8ynrKojF4
transaction
05abe8c26cf172dd1abcdeb1fe23e829e9e54f11900f372670c4b22f8a997983
confirmations
440494
spent
true